Re: How to Customize a Custom Rom: Adding/Removing Programs

Quote:
Originally Posted by hasseye View Post
heyy guyss gotta question. Still trying to build my own roms. I'm so close to finishing to. Everytime i build it in buildos it works great, compiles it great, then i click on buildit...seems like it works okay...i go to ruu to flash it and i look at the ruu_signed.nbh and its only 1kb. Its like nothing is in there. I even try clicking on the update utility and it errors out, probably because there is nothing in the file. Anybody know why it's doing this. I get no errors in buildos, it creates the temp file as well. i assume that the problem lies around the buildit part.
This kitchen unfortunately has a size limitation. (it was built back in the apache days...) Can't build anything over ca. 125 meg's

I have migrated over and use calcu's kitchen now, a brief 15 line tutorial/how to can be found here. I'll create a new tutorial soon. Or convert this kitchen.
